VFS Capital Limited, a Kolkata-based leading NBFC-MFI felicitated six rural women entrepreneurs of West Bengal, to recognize their courage and power of breaking all the stereotypes and venture into the business world to alleviate poverty and lead a respectful life in society. Dinesh Kumar Khara, Chairman of the State Bank of India, felicitated the entrepreneurs at a glittering ceremony held in Kolkata on Friday.

The women entrepreneurs who were felicitated were: Raunaque Jahan Ansari, a resident of Bankra Howrah, who is into the readymade clothing business; Mala Manna, a resident of Amta, Howrah who is into the stamp ticket business;  Rumpa Dolui, a resident of Ranihati, Howrah, who is into zari work; Papiya Manna, a resident of Jujarsaha, Howrah, who is into tailoring work; Sagari Ruidas, a resident of Panpur, Howrah, who sells sarees and Chaitali Chakraborty, a resident of Bilaspur, Howrah, who sells phenyl

The event was a testament to the power of women's entrepreneurship in alleviating poverty and driving economic growth. VFS Capital has supported these women entrepreneurs in their journey by providing financial assistance and training. Their contributions have helped these women realize their dreams, contribute to the local economy's development and create employment opportunities for others.

Speaking on the occasion, Kuldip Maity, MD & CEO of VFS Capital said, "We believe the success stories of these women entrepreneurs will inspire many more women to follow their dreams of creating successful businesses and create employment opportunities in rural areas, and we at VFS Capital, remain committed to providing them with the necessary financial resources and support to continue their entrepreneurial journey."

Another highlight of the event was the launch of noted author, Tamal Bandyopadhyay's book ‘Roller Coaster: An Affair with Banking’. The special session around the launch of this book was organised in association with Jaico Publishing House.

The event was also attended by  Soma Sankara Prasad, MD & CEO, UCO Bank; Chandra Shekhar Ghosh, MD & CEO, Bandhan Bank; Harsh V Lodha, Chairperson, MP Birla Group; Partha Sarathi Bhattacharyya, Chairperson, Peerless Group, and former Chairman, Coal India, and D.N. Ghosh, former Chairperson, SBI, and Chairman Emeritus of ICRA Limited.
